Why Register a Private Limited Company?
A private limited company under the Companies Act, 2013 offers:
- Limited liability — shareholders' personal assets are protected
- Separate legal entity — can contract, own property, sue, and be sued in its own name
- Perpetual succession — continues regardless of changes in shareholders or directors
- Tax efficiency — corporate tax at 22% (Section 115BAA) vs. 30% for individuals in highest slab
- Credibility — preferred by investors, banks, and large enterprises
Legal Framework
Key provisions under the Companies Act, 2013:
- Section 2(68) — Private company: minimum 2, maximum 200 shareholders; share transfer restricted
- Section 3 — Formation requires minimum 2 persons
- Section 149 — Minimum 2 directors; at least one must be a resident of India (≥ 182 days in previous calendar year)
Prerequisites
Each director needs a Director Identification Number (DIN) and a Class 3 Digital Signature Certificate (DSC) issued by a licensed certifying authority (eMudhra, Sify, NSDL).
Step-by-Step Registration Process
Step 1 — Obtain DSC
Class 3 DSC required for all proposed directors to sign electronic forms on MCA21.Step 2 — Name Reservation via RUN
File RUN (Reserve Unique Name) application on MCA21 with 2 preferences. Approved within 2-3 working days. Reservation valid for 20 days.Step 3 — Draft MOA and AOA
- Memorandum of Association (MOA) — defines the company's objects and liability clause (Table A/B templates under Companies (Incorporation) Rules, 2014)
- Articles of Association (AOA) — internal governance rules (Table F template for private companies)
Step 4 — File SPICe+ Form
SPICe+ is the single integrated form bundling:- Incorporation (INC-32) + DIN allotment for proposed directors
- PAN and TAN allotment via NSDL
- EPFO and ESIC registration
- GST registration (optional — via AGILE-PRO-S)
- Professional Tax registration (state-specific)
Step 5 — ROC Scrutiny and Certificate of Incorporation
The ROC issues the Certificate of Incorporation (COI) carrying the Company Identification Number (CIN) within 5-10 working days.Documents Required
From each director: PAN card, Aadhaar card (self-attested), passport-size photograph, proof of residential address (not older than 2 months).
For registered office: Electricity bill / property tax receipt, NOC from owner if rented, rent agreement.

Post-Incorporation Compliance
- Open current account within 30 days
- File PAS-3 (Return of Allotment) within 30 days of share issuance
- Hold first board meeting within 30 days (Section 173)
- Appoint statutory auditor — file ADT-1 within 15 days (Section 139)
- Register for GST if turnover threshold is met
